Research on the microstructure and mechanical properties of PEEK composite 3D printed prefabricated wire
In order to optimize the comprehensive mechanical properties of polyetheretherketone(PEEK)materials,researchers prepared composite PEEK filaments containing different proportions of carbon fiber(CF)and glass fiber(GF).Researchers used the GB/T 1447-2005 fiber-reinforced plastic tensile performance test method to test the mechanical properties of composite filaments containing different components,and studied their microstructure using scanning electron microscopy(SEM).The results indicate that the strength of PEEK/CF composite wire increases with the increase of CF content.The strength of PEEK/GF composite wire also increases with the increase of GF content.The strength of composite wire with 10%GF added is significantly higher than that of pure PEEK wire,but the overall strength improvement is slow as the GF content continues to increase.
